Monetary policy – NBR Board decisions

According to the press release of National Bank of Romania dated July 4th, the Board of the National Bank of Romania decided: to keep the monetary policy rate at 2.50 percent per annum; to leave unchanged the deposit facility rate at 1.50 percent per annum and the lending facility rate at 3.50 percent per annum; and to maintain the existing levels of minimum reserve requirement ratios on both leu- and foreign currency-denominated liabilities of credit institutions.

NBR: Inflation Report

Developments in inflation and its determinants

The annual CPI inflation rate consolidated in positive territory, reaching 0.85 percent in June, after having posted a notable increase in Q2 (+0.67 percentage points versus end-Q1). Its path reflected upward domestic pressures, arising from the pick-up in companies’ production costs, whose pass-through into end-user prices for consumer goods is favoured by the opening of the positive output gap.
